United States — NASA has announced the crew for the Artemis II mission, marking the first lunar trip since 1972. The crew includes Commander Reid Wiseman, Pilot Victor Glover, and Mission Specialists Christina Koch and Jeremy Hansen from the Canada — Canadian Space Agency. This mission aims to pave the path for future moon landings, with a practice docking mission planned for 2027 and a moon landing in 2028. The diversified crew, including a woman, a person of color, and a Canadian, reflects a shift from the Apollo era. While they won't land on the Moon, the 10-day journey will take them deeper into space than previous Apollo missions, offering unprecedented views of the lunar far side.
